首页 > 后端开发 > 正文

php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现

2025-04-07 06:12:55 | 我爱编程网

php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现很多朋友对这方面很关心,我爱编程网整理了相关文章,供大家参考,一起来看一下吧!

本文目录一览:

php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现

PHP strtotime函数详解

PHP中的strtotime函数是一个能将各种英文文本日期时间描述转换为Unix时间戳的函数 。以下是关于strtotime函数的详细解释:

  1. 功能

    • strtotime函数能将英文文本日期时间描述转换为Unix时间戳,即自1970年1月1日00:00:00 GMT以来的秒数。
  2. 输入

    • strtotime函数接受一个日期字符串作为输入,如”2008820”、”10 September 2000”等。
    • 它也可以解析以当前时间为基础的时间描述,如”+1 day”、”last Thursday”等。
  3. 输出

    • 函数返回的是Unix时间戳。
    • 如果解析失败,在PHP 5.1.0及以后的版本中,函数返回FALSE;在旧版本中,返回1。
  4. 支持的日期和时间表示方式

    • strtotime函数支持多种日期和时间的表示方式,包括月份、星期、年份等。
    • 它还支持时间的加减和相对时间的表示,如”ago”、”tomorrow”、”yesterday”等。
  5. 时区考虑

    • strtotime函数会考虑PHP脚本运行时的时区设置。
    • 在PHP 5.1.0及以后的版本中,可以通过date_default_timezone_get函数获取或设置默认时区。
  6. 应用场景

    • strtotime函数常用于日期时间的计算和比较。
    • 通过结合strtotime函数和date或mktime函数,开发者可以灵活地处理和操作日期时间,实现各种日期计算需求。

总结 :PHP中的strtotime函数是一个功能强大的日期时间解析工具,它支持多种日期和时间的表示方式,并能将文本日期时间描述转换为Unix时间戳。掌握这个函数对于处理时间相关操作的PHP开发者来说是非常重要的。

php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现

php中strtolower的函数功能

在Web开发过程中,字符串处理是一项不可或缺的技能。其中,处理字符串的大小写问题尤为关键,尤其是在涉及密码验证、URL地址处理等场景。在PHP中,为我们提供了丰富的字符串处理函数,其中strtolower函数便是其中之一,其主要功能是将字符串全部转换为小写字母。


一、strtolower函数的基本功能


PHP中的strtolower函数是一个强大的工具,用于将输入的字符串完全转化为小写形式。其语法简洁明了:


语法: `strtolower(string $str)`


在这里,$str是待转换的字符串,函数返回转换后的小写字符串。


二、示例说明


让我们通过一个简单的示例来展示strtolower函数的使用:


假设我们有一个包含大写字母的字符串,使用strtolower函数后,所有大写字母都会被转换为小写字母,并返回转换后的结果。


三、注意事项


1. 使用strtolower函数时,需要注意字符集的问题。该函数主要针对ASCII字符集进行设计,对于其他字符集,可能会出现不可预期的结果。因此,在处理非ASCII字符时,要确保字符集的兼容性。


2. 在PHP中,字符串的大小写敏感性取决于具体的应用场景。例如,在MySQL数据库中,表名和列名的大小写是敏感的,而变量名和函数名则是大小写不敏感的。因此,在使用PHP处理字符串时,需要根据具体情境来判断是否需要考虑字符串的大小写问题。


除了上述注意事项,还需要注意的是,strtolower函数在处理字符串时非常高效,能够快速地完成字符串的小写转换,因此在性能要求较高的场景下,该函数是一个理想的选择。


总的来说,PHP中的strtolower函数是一个实用的工具,能够帮助开发者轻松处理字符串的大小写问题。在Web开发过程中,掌握该函数的使用方法和注意事项,将有助于提高开发效率和代码质量。

PHP 语法字符串函数 strcmp、strlen 使用及实现

我爱编程网(https://www.52biancheng.com)小编还为大家带来PHP 语法字符串函数 strcmp、strlen 使用及实现的相关内容。

PHP 语法字符串函数 strcmp、strlen 的使用及实现

strcmp 功能 :用于比较两个字符串。 用法 :int strcmp $str1 和 $str2 是要比较的两个字符串。 返回值: 若 $str1 小于 $str2,则返回小于 0 的值。 若 $str1 等于 $str2,则返回 0。 若 $str1 大于 $str2,则返回大于 0 的值。 实现 :基于 C 内置函数 memcmp 实现,高效地进行字符串比较。 我爱编程网

strlen 功能 :获取字符串的长度。 用法 :int strlen $string 是要获取长度的字符串。 返回值:返回字符串的长度。 实现 :直接获取 zval.zend_value.zend_string.len 的值,高效且简洁。

总结 内置函数的高效性 :strcmp 和 strlen 作为 PHP 的内置函数,在执行效率上比用户自定义函数更高,因为它们无需经过编译阶段,直接注册定义即可使用。 底层实现 :这些内置函数的底层实现与 C 语言中的函数相辅相成,利用了 C 语言的高效特性,如 strcmp 基于 memcmp 实现。

理解这些内置函数的实现原理有助于更深入地掌握 PHP 语言,并为进一步的 PHP 开发打下坚实的基础。

以上就是我爱编程网为大家带来的php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现,希望能帮助到大家!更多相关文章关注我爱编程网:www.52biancheng.com

免责声明:文章内容来自网络,如有侵权请及时联系删除。
标签: PHP
与“php中strtolower的函数功能 PHP 语法字符串函数 strcmp、strlen 使用及实现”相关推荐
php函数变量前有类型 PHP 语法字符串函数 strcmp、strlen 使用及实现
php函数变量前有类型 PHP 语法字符串函数 strcmp、strlen 使用及实现

100个最常用的PHP函数(记得收藏哦)由于篇幅限制,无法详细列出100个最常用的PHP函数,但我可以概述一些核心类别和高频函数,帮助您快速了解PHP开发中的关键函数。以下是一些最常用的PHP函数分类及部分高频函数:字符串处理strlen:获取字符串长度。strpos:查找字符串首次出现的位置。str_replace:替换字符串中的子串。

2025-04-02 15:45:41
PHP 语法字符串函数 strcmp、strlen 使用及实现 [php]foreach($_POST as $key => $val) $$key=trim($val);
PHP 语法字符串函数 strcmp、strlen 使用及实现 [php]foreach($_POST as $key => $val) $$key=trim($val);

PHP语法字符串函数strcmp、strlen使用及实现PHP语法字符串函数strcmp、strlen的使用及实现:strcmp:功能:用于比较两个字符串。用法:intstrcmp$str1和$str2是要比较的两个字符串。返回值:若$str1小于$str2,则返回小于0的值。若$str1等于$str2,则返回0。若$str1大于$str2,则返回大于0的

2025-04-06 17:06:33
使用php is _int() 判断是否为整数的问题(PHP 语法字符串函数 strcmp、strlen 使用及实现)
使用php is _int() 判断是否为整数的问题(PHP 语法字符串函数 strcmp、strlen 使用及实现)

使用phpis_int()判断是否为整数的问题is_int判断变量类型是否为整数类型。语法:intis_int(mixedvar);返回值:整数函数种类:PHP系统功能内容说明若变量为整数类型则返回true,否则返回false。你要确保$a这个变量是一个整数类型的值PHP语法字符串函数strcmp、strlen使用及实现

2025-04-03 01:28:35
php中strtolower的函数功能 php中替换字符串函数strtr()和str_repalce()的
php中strtolower的函数功能 php中替换字符串函数strtr()和str_repalce()的

php中strtolower的函数功能在Web开发过程中,字符串处理是一项不可或缺的技能。其中,处理字符串的大小写问题尤为关键,尤其是在涉及密码验证、URL地址处理等场景。在PHP中,为我们提供了丰富的字符串处理函数,其中strtolower函数便是其中之一,其主要功能是将字符串全部转换为小写字母。一、strtolower函数的基本功能PHP中的strtolower函数是一

2024-08-22 17:20:30
PHP字符串长度计算 - strlen()函数使用介绍(php截取字符串几个实用的函数)
PHP字符串长度计算 - strlen()函数使用介绍(php截取字符串几个实用的函数)

PHP字符串长度计算-strlen()函数使用介绍strlen()函数和mb_strlen()函数在PHP中,函数strlen()返回字符串的长度。函数原型如下:复制代码代码如下:intstrlen(stringstring_input);参数string_input为要处理的字符串。strlen()函数返回字符串所占的字节长度,一个英文字母、数字、各种符号均

2025-01-23 20:14:53
PHP中strcmp()和strcasecmp()函数字符串比较用法分析 php strncmp语法
PHP中strcmp()和strcasecmp()函数字符串比较用法分析 php strncmp语法

PHPstrcmp()和strcasecmp()的区别实例这篇文章主要介绍了PHP中strcmp()和strcasecmp()函数字符串比较用法,结合实例形式较为详细的分析了strcmp()和strcasecmp()函数的功能,使用方法与区别本文实例讲述了PHP中strcmp()和strcasecmp()函数字符串比较用法。分享给大家供大家参考,具体如下:一、PHP中strcmp()

2024-12-07 16:13:23
php截取长度函数 php的字符串strlen()方法
php截取长度函数 php的字符串strlen()方法

php截取字符串函数PHP中,字符串截取是非常常见的操作。通过使用substr函数,我们可以按照指定位置或长度获取字符串的一部分。以下是一些示例:首先,substr函数用于从指定位置开始取字符,如从字符串"ABCDEFGHIJKLMNOPQRSTUVWXYZ"的第5个字符开始取,直到字符串结束,结果为"BZYX"。接着,可以指定截取的长度,如从第9个字符开始取4个字符,得到"DE

2024-12-19 01:40:01
php中strtolower的函数功能(PHP下编码转换函数mb_convert_encoding与iconv的使用说明)
php中strtolower的函数功能(PHP下编码转换函数mb_convert_encoding与iconv的使用说明)

php中strtolower的函数功能在Web开发过程中,字符串处理是一项不可或缺的技能。其中,处理字符串的大小写问题尤为关键,尤其是在涉及密码验证、URL地址处理等场景。在PHP中,为我们提供了丰富的字符串处理函数,其中strtolower函数便是其中之一,其主要功能是将字符串全部转换为小写字母。一、strtolower函数的基本功能PHP中的strtolower函数是一

2024-10-16 02:52:11